单选题
寄存器的作用是()
A
进行逻辑运算
B
产生控制信号
C
临时存储数据,中间结果、地址和状态信息
D
暂存被操作数
答案解析
正确答案:C
解析:
好的,让我们来详细解析这道题。
### 题目:寄存器的作用是()
#### 选项分析:
- **A. 进行逻辑运算**
- **解析**:逻辑运算通常是由逻辑门电路或处理器中的算术逻辑单元(ALU)完成的,而不是寄存器的主要功能。寄存器主要用于存储数据,而不是进行计算。
- **B. 产生控制信号**
- **解析**:控制信号的生成通常是由控制单元(如CPU中的控制单元)负责的,而不是寄存器。寄存器的主要作用是存储数据,而不是生成控制信号。
- **C. 临时存储数据,中间结果、地址和状态信息**
- **解析**:这是正确的答案。寄存器的主要功能是临时存储数据、中间结果、地址和状态信息。这些信息在计算机执行指令时需要快速访问,寄存器提供了高速的存储空间。
- **D. 暂存被操作数**
- **解析**:这个选项部分正确,但不够全面。寄存器确实可以暂存被操作数,但这只是它功能的一部分。更全面的描述应该是选项C,因为它涵盖了更多的用途。
### 为什么选C?
寄存器的主要作用是提供一个高速的临时存储空间,用于存储数据、中间结果、地址和状态信息。这些信息在计算机执行指令时需要频繁访问,因此寄存器的设计目的是为了提高数据访问速度,从而加快指令的执行效率。
### 示例
假设你在编写一个程序,需要进行一系列复杂的计算。在计算过程中,你可能会用到一些中间结果,这些中间结果需要暂时保存起来,以便后续使用。寄存器就是用来存储这些中间结果的。例如:
1. **加载数据**:从内存中加载一个数值到寄存器。
2. **计算**:在寄存器中进行加法、减法等运算。
3. **存储结果**:将计算结果存储回内存或另一个寄存器。
在这个过程中,寄存器起到了临时存储数据和中间结果的作用,确保计算过程高效进行。
相关题目
单选题
()为确保安全,户外变电装置的围墙高度一般应不低于3米
单选题
()为使晶体三极管放大输出波形不失真除需设置适当的静态工作点外,还需要采取稳定工作点的方法,且输入信号幅度要适中
单选题
()为消除三次谐波的影响,发电机的三相绕组大都采用三角形接法
单选题
()涡流只会使铁心发热,不会增加电能损耗
单选题
()我国采用的颜色标志的含义基本上与国际安全色标准相同
单选题
()无论备用电源是否有电压,只要工作电源断路器跳闸,备用电源断路器均自动投入
单选题
()无人值班的变配电所中的电力电缆线路,每周至少应进行一次巡视检查
单选题
()锡的熔点比铅高
单选题
()系统的高低压一次侧负荷电流无论多大,电流互感器的二次电流都统一为1A
单选题
()现代高压开关中都采取了迅速拉长电弧的措施灭弧,如采用强力分闸弹簧,其分闸速度已达16m/s以上
